[Bug 1029527] New: zypper outputs the message: "warning: Unsupported version of key: V3"
http://bugzilla.opensuse.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1029527 Bug ID: 1029527 Summary: zypper outputs the message: "warning: Unsupported version of key: V3" Classification: openSUSE Product: openSUSE Tumbleweed Version: Current Hardware: Other OS: Other Status: NEW Severity: Minor Priority: P5 - None Component: libzypp Assignee: zypp-maintainers@forge.provo.novell.com Reporter: sonichedgehog_hyperblast00@yahoo.com QA Contact: qa-bugs@suse.de Found By: --- Blocker: --- Whenever I install any packages with zypper, I get the following warning printed to the console (per installed package): Additional rpm output: warning: Unsupported version of key: V3 This doesn't seem to break anything, and the update process continues as usual. It is however an unusual message and possibly denotes an issue.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ug.

--- Comment #2 from Dominique Leuenberger
rpm -vv -qf /etc
That will give you quite some output, and you will find something along the line: ? D: read h# 168 Header sanity check: OK ? warning: Unsupported version of key: V3 Here, the 'ID 168' is interesting. you can find out what the key in question is:
rpm -q --querybynumber 168
get further information on it after you have the key info:
rpm -qi gpg-pubkey-3d25d3d9-36e12d04
and decide to finally delete the key
rpm -e gpg-pubkey-3d25d3d9-36e12d04
NOTE: the IDs and KEY INFO ABOVE IS LIKELY NOT MATCHING YOUR SETUP! Adjust the information accordingly -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ug.
